Understanding Star Note Value: A Guide to Rare Currency Assessment

In the realm of numismatics, the value of currency extends beyond its face value. This is particularly true for collectors and enthusiasts who seek out rare and unique pieces. Among these, star notes hold a special place. Star notes are replacement banknotes issued by the Bureau of Engraving and Printing in the United States to replace misprinted or damaged notes. These notes are distinguished by a star symbol that appears in the serial number, replacing one of the letters.

What Makes Star Notes Valuable?

The value of a star note is determined by several factors, including its rarity, condition, and demand among collectors. Rarity is often the most significant factor, as notes from certain series or denominations may have been printed in smaller quantities. Additionally, the condition of the note plays a crucial role; notes that are crisp and free from damage are more valuable than those that show signs of wear and tear.

Rarity and Series

Star notes from certain series are rarer than others, which can significantly impact their value. For example, star notes from older series or those with lower print runs are often more valuable. Collectors often seek out notes from specific series to complete their collections, driving up demand and value for these rarer pieces.

Condition and Grading

The condition of a star note is assessed using a grading system that ranges from poor to uncirculated. Uncirculated notes, which show no signs of wear, are the most valuable. Collectors often prefer notes that have been professionally graded, as this provides assurance of the note’s condition and authenticity.

Personal accounting software has become an essential tool for individuals looking to manage their finances efficiently. These applications help track income, expenses, investments, and savings while providing valuable insights into spending habits. QuickBooks, a well-established name in financial software, offers a dedicated personal finance solution that simplifies budgeting, tax preparation, and financial planning. With features like automatic transaction categorization, bill reminders, and customizable reports, QuickBooks ensures users have full control over their financial data. Why Choose QuickBooks for Personal Finance? QuickBooks is widely recognized for its business accounting capabilities, but its personal finance features are equally impressive. Here are some key reasons why QuickBooks stands out: Automated Transaction Tracking: Syncs with bank accounts and credit cards to automatically import and categorize transactions. Budgeting Tools: Allows users to set monthly budgets and track progress in real-time. Tax Preparation Support: Helps organize deductible expenses and generates reports for tax filing. Customizable Reports: Provides detailed financial reports, including cash flow, net worth, and spending trends. Mobile Accessibility: Offers a user-friendly mobile app for managing finances on the go. Best SUV for 2024: Top Picks for Performance, Comfort, and Safety

The automotive industry has seen remarkable advancements in SUV design and technology in 2024. Manufacturers are focusing on hybrid and electric options, enhanced driver-assistance systems, and premium interiors to meet evolving consumer demands. Below is an in-depth analysis of the best SUVs for 2024, categorized by their standout features. Top 2024 SUVs by Category Best Family SUV: 2024 Honda CR-V The 2024 Honda CR-V remains a top choice for families, thanks to its spacious cabin, smooth ride, and excellent fuel economy. The hybrid variant offers even greater efficiency, making it ideal for long trips. Standard safety features include adaptive cruise control, lane-keeping assist, and automatic emergency braking. Best Off-Road SUV: 2024 Toyota 4Runner For adventure seekers, the 2024 Toyota 4Runner stands out with its rugged build and off-road capabilities. Equipped with a powerful V6 engine and advanced four-wheel-drive system, it handles challenging terrains with ease. The TRD Pro trim includes specialized off-road features like skid plates and upgraded suspension. Best Luxury SUV: 2024 BMW X5 The 2024 BMW X5 combines luxury with performance, offering a refined interior, cutting-edge technology, and powerful engine options. The plug-in hybrid variant delivers impressive fuel efficiency without compromising on power. Features like a panoramic sunroof and premium sound system enhance the driving experience. The Coolest Compact SUV Models of 2025: Top-Rated Small SUVs for Every Driver

Compact SUVs dominate the automotive market due to their practicality, efficiency, and modern appeal. These vehicles strike a balance between the spaciousness of larger SUVs and the agility of smaller cars, making them ideal for city driving and weekend getaways alike. With advancements in hybrid and electric technology, many models now offer impressive fuel economy without sacrificing performance. Safety features like adaptive cruise control, lane-keeping assist, and automatic emergency braking have become standard in most top-rated small SUVs, ensuring peace of mind for drivers and passengers. Top-Rated Small SUVs of 2025 The following models represent the best in the compact SUV category, each excelling in different areas such as performance, technology, and affordability. 1. Honda CR-V The Honda CR-V remains a top choice for its reliability, spacious interior, and fuel-efficient hybrid option. The 2025 model features a sleek redesign, improved infotainment system, and enhanced driver-assistance technologies. With ample cargo space and comfortable seating, it’s perfect for families and long-distance travelers. 2. Mazda CX-5 Known for its upscale interior and sporty handling, the Mazda CX-5 stands out in the luxury compact SUV segment. The turbocharged engine option delivers spirited performance, while the refined cabin offers premium materials and a quiet ride. Its intuitive infotainment system and advanced safety features make it a well-rounded choice. 3. Toyota RAV4 The Toyota RAV4 continues to impress with its rugged styling, excellent fuel economy, and available hybrid and plug-in hybrid variants. The Adventure and TRD Off-Road trims cater to outdoor enthusiasts, while the spacious interior and user-friendly tech appeal to daily commuters. 4. Subaru Forester With standard all-wheel drive and impressive ground clearance, the Subaru Forester is a go-to for those who prioritize all-weather capability. The spacious cabin, excellent visibility, and top safety ratings make it a practical choice for families and adventure seekers alike. 5. Ford Escape The Ford Escape offers a comfortable ride, peppy turbocharged engine options, and a well-designed interior. The plug-in hybrid variant provides an impressive electric-only range, making it a great option for eco-conscious buyers. Its user-friendly SYNC infotainment system adds to the appeal.
